Andover, NH Local Guide

Largest Available Andover and Nearby Studio Apartments

The largest available Studio apartment unit in Andover, NH is found at 75 Bank St and is 645 square feet priced from $1,980. 241 S Main St has the second largest Studio, which is sized at 477 square feet and currently listed start at $1,650. Here is today’s list of the largest available Studio units in Andover:

Apartment ListingModel NameSquare FootagePriced From
75 Bank St645 Sq Ft$1,980
241 S Main StLoft477 Sq Ft$1,650
1 Pleasant StStudio450 Sq Ft$1,095
77 Rush RoadStudio, 1 bath434 Sq Ft$1,375
South BlockStudio417 Sq Ft$1,750

Cheapest Available Andover and Nearby Studio Apartments

As of August 02, 2026 the lowest priced Studio apartment unit in Andover, NH is the Studio Model starting from $1,095 at 1 Pleasant St . The second most affordable Andover Studio is the Studio Model at 241 S Main St starting at $1,290 . The average price for all Studio apartments in Andover is currently $1,912.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available Studio options in Andover:

Apartment ListingModel NamePriced From
1 Pleasant StStudio$1,095
241 S Main StStudio$1,290
77 Rush RoadStudio, 1 bath$1,375
South BlockStudio$1,750

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Andover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Andover with Studio?

Currently the most affordable Studio in Andover is at 1 Pleasant St listed at $1,095.

How much is the average rent for a Studio Andover Apartment?

The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Andover is $1,912.

What is the largest available Studio Andover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Andover is a 645 square feet unit starting from $1,980 at 75 Bank St.

What is the average size for Andover Studio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Studio rental in Andover is currently 459 sq ft.
